It has been more than half a century since the first appearance of 'Abdullah Yusuf 'Ali's superlative work, The Holy Quran: Text, Translation and Commentary. Since that time, there have been innumerable reprinting and millions of copies distributed throughout the world. It is, by far, the best known, most studied, and most respected English translation of the Qur'an It was the first monumental and authoritative work of its kind and it subsequently inspired many such similar endeavors. The eloquent poetic of the translation and the authenticity of the extensive commentaries and explanatory notes, have, no doubt, contributed greatly to its much deserved reputation as the English ranslation of the meaning of the Qur'an.
The form of this newly revised edition has undergone a more dramatic change in and has been vastly improved in order to facilitate its readability and study. The type for the English text has been completely reset for the first time, thereby making the character definition more legible after many years of reprinting. Abdullah Yusuf Ali says in the Preface to the first edition 'The English shall be, not mere substitute of one word for another, but the best expression I can give to the fullest meaning which I can understand from the Arabic text. The rhythm, music, and exalted tone of the original should be reflected in the English interpretation. It may be but a faint reflection, but such beauty and power as my pen commands shall be brought to it's service'

Obligation and Timing:
All adult Muslims who are physically and psychologically capable must fast during the month of Ramadan. The sighting of the new moon determines the start and end of Ramadan, and fasting begins at dawn (Fajr) and ends at nightfall (Maghrib).
Intention:
It is critical to have a serious intention to fast each day before sunrise. The purpose can be formed in the heart and does not need to be expressed verbally.
Invalidators:
While fasting, Muslims are supposed to refrain from eating, drinking, and engaging in personal connections from the start of Fajr prayer until sunset. It is also vital to avoid doing anything that will invalidate the fast, such as purposely vomiting or breaking the fast.
Exceptions & Exemptions:
Certain events, such as illness, travel, menstruation, postpartum bleeding, pregnancy, and breastfeeding, may exempt people from fasting. Except for those with chronic disease or advanced age, who may be compelled to provide fidyah (feeding a needy person) instead, these people must make up for the missed fasts at a later date.
Taraweeh Prayer:
The Taraweeh prayer is an optional prayer conducted after the required Isha prayer during the evenings of Ramadan. It is highly recommended and traditionally consists of congregational recitation of lengthy passages of the Qur'an.

Imam Muhammad al-Shaybani -- He is Abu ‘Abdullah Muhammad ibn al-Hasan ibn Farqad al-Shaybani. Muhammad was born in Wasit in 132 AH, and grew up in Kufa. He was a pupil of Abu Hanifah. Imam Shafi’i said, "I have not seen anyone more eloquent than him. I used to think when I saw him reciting the Qur’an that it was as if the Qur’an had been revealed in his language."
He also said, "I have not seen anyone more itelligent than Muhammad ibn al-Hasan." Dhahabi said, "He narrated from Malik ibn Anas and others, and he was one of the great oceans of knowledge and fiqh, and he was strong [when he narrated] from Malik." Muhammad said, "I stood at Malik’s door for three years and I heard [the Muwatta’] from him [with] more than seven hundred hadith." He died in Rayy in 189 AH.

The version of the Muwatta narrated by Imam Muhammad ibn al-Hasan al-Shaybani, one of the two leading pupils of Imam Abu Hanifah, directly from his three years of study with Imam Malik will be of particular interest not only to students of Hanafi fiqh, but also to students of hadith in general. Imam Malik composed the Muwatta’ over a period of forty years to represent the "well-trodden path" of the people of Madina.
Its name also means that it is the book that is "many times agreed upon"— about whose contents the people of Madina were unanimously agreed—and that is "made easy and facilitated". Its high standing is such that people of every school of fiqh and all of the imams of hadith scholarship agree upon its authenticity. Imam Shafi’i said, "There is not on the face of the earth—after the Book of Allah—a book which is more sahih than the book of Malik."
Shah Wali Allah Dihlawi (1114-1176 AH) said, "My breast expanded and I became certain that the Muwatta’ is the most sahih book to be found on the earth after the Book of Allah." Imam Malik -- Imam Malik is the imam of the imams, the leader of the people of knowledge of Madinah, Malik ibn Anas ibn Malik ibn Abi ‘Amir al-Asbahi al-Madani, born in 94 AH, 95 AH or even 99 AH. He was called the Man of Knowledge of Madina. People of knowledge understood that it was him the Prophet saw indicated in the hadith from Abu Hurayra.
"People will soon beat the livers of their camels [in traveling in search of knowledge] but they will not find a man of knowledge more knowledgeable than the man of knowledge of Madina." Among his pupils were the Imams Sufyan ath-Thawri, Sa’id ibn Mansur, ‘Abdullah ibn al-Mubarak, ‘Abd ar-Rahman al-Awza’I who was older than him, Layth ibn Sa’d who was one of his peers, Imam al-Shafi’i, Muhammad ibn al-Hasan al-Shaybani, the Malikis ‘Abd ar-Rahman ibn al-Qasim, Yahya ibn Yahya al-Laythi, Ibn Wahb, and Dhu’n-Nun al-Misri. He died in 179 AH on the morning of the 14th of Rabi’ al-Awwal.

Introducing the world’s first picture dictionary of the Quran’s 2,000+ entries, with the goal of empowering the majority of Muslims (who are not Arabs) to read the Quran in its original, rich Arabic form in just 4-6 months, without having to rely on translations. Five years in the works, this dictionary highlights the connection between all words that share the same root. It’s very straightforward, not indulging in redundant details or overly academic discussions that make the book irrelevant.
Top 10 Reasons Why You Should Study This Dictionary:
This is the first modern dictionary of the Quran to utilize visuals to explain Quranic entries, featuring over 2,000 images and illustrations.
This qâmûs (dictionary) highlights the connection between all derivatives of the same root. So you will learn, for example, what the derivatives of j-n-n ج ن ن have in common (namely, jan-nah ‘Paradise,’ jinn ‘jinn,’ ajin-nah ‘fetuses,’ and maj-nûn ‘insane’).
It covers the Quran’s 2,092 entries, including 947 verbs, 1,045 nouns, and 100 particles, arranged by frequency and theme.
These 2,092 entries, repeated 107,540 times throughout the Quran, are followed by 7,835 Quranic examples highlighting the most common forms.
This is the first Quran dictionary to feature a remarkable 9-page list of all entries in 242 coupled rhymes, making it easy for students to test their mastery of Quranic words.

This book is a translation of Ibn 'Aqil al-Hanbali's (d. 513/1119) essay on Islamic manners, Fusül al-ādāb wa makārim al-akhlāq al-mashrū'a. It presents a significant number of commendable etiquettes Muslims are required to observe for everyday living and dealings. Ibn 'Aqil's essay is considered to be the shortest, and the earliest extant work from the Hanbali school on Islamic manners. Shaykh Bakr Abu Zayd said in al-Madkhal al-Mufassal, Zād al-Mustaqnī’ fī Ikhtisār al-Muqni’ is the text that came to be considered as the main source for the study of the Hanbalī madhab (school of jurisprudence) and quintessential for the students in the land of the Hanābilah (i.e. the Arabian Peninsula); particularly in the region of Najd. The people busied themselves reading, memorising and writing commentaries upon this book. This was carried out in study circles in the masājid where the scholars imparted knowledge to others and also in formal learning institutions.
This book was studied in-depth so much so that some scholars provided explanations just upon the phrases within it so as to make it easy for the new learner. This was expanded to include proofs and evidences for those in the intermediate level. In the levels thereafter, proofs and evidences were fused with the disputes that exist within the madhab and in comparison to the other madhabs. Some scholars said: The texts of Zād and Bulūgh, Suffice for one to attain genius. They indicated through this [the importance of] Zād al-Mustaqni’ with regards to the study of fiqh and Bulūgh al-Marām with regards to the study of hadīth.
No book as exemplary has been authored since it that contains as many important points (muhimāt) and issues (masā’il) as Zād. In fact, Zād excelled in terms of quantity and content. It is said that there are approximately three thousand important points and issues mentioned and similarly another three thousand inferred from the text. Meaning that it possesses within it around six thousand issues. This is what we heard from some of the noble scholars of the madhab in our time. While [in the current time] the students of knowledge transmit from some of the contemporary scholars that the number of issues in Zād goes beyond thirty thousand. Thus one should not avoid it.
